best answer: can i cook chicken the night before?
Cooking chicken the night before can be a smart move to save time and effort. You can prepare a large batch of chicken and refrigerate it, making it easy to reheat and enjoy later. However, it’s important to ensure the chicken is cooked properly and stored correctly to prevent spoilage. Cook the chicken thoroughly and let it cool to room temperature before refrigerating. Store the cooked chicken in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. When ready to serve, reheat the chicken thoroughly to an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C) before consuming.

can i cook chicken and eat it the next day?
Cooking chicken and eating it the next day can be a great way to save time and have a quick meal on hand. However, it’s important to follow proper food safety guidelines to ensure that your chicken is safe to eat. First, make sure to cook the chicken to an internal temperature of 165 degrees Fahrenheit. This will kill any harmful bacteria. Once the chicken is cooked, let it cool slightly before storing it in an airtight container in the refrigerator. The chicken can be stored in the refrigerator for up to three days. When you’re ready to eat the chicken, reheat it to an internal temperature of 165 degrees Fahrenheit before serving. This will ensure that the chicken is safe to eat and that any harmful bacteria that may have grown during storage is killed.

can you prepare stuffed chicken breasts ahead of time?
You can prepare stuffed chicken breasts ahead of time to save time and effort on the day you plan to cook them. To do so, simply stuff the chicken breasts with your desired filling, wrap them tightly in plastic wrap, and refrigerate for up to 24 hours. When ready to cook, remove the chicken from the refrigerator and allow it to come to room temperature for about 30 minutes before baking or grilling. This method ensures that the chicken cooks evenly and stays moist and flavorful.

can you cook chicken in two stages?
Cooking chicken in two stages can yield tender and juicy results. First, season the chicken liberally and place it on a baking sheet, then roast it at a high temperature for a short period. This creates a delicious crust while preserving moisture. Next, reduce the oven temperature and continue roasting until the internal temperature reaches the desired doneness. This two-stage method ensures evenly cooked chicken without drying it out.

is raw chicken ok in the fridge for 5 days?
Raw chicken should not be stored in the refrigerator for more than 1-2 days, as it can quickly spoil and become unsafe to eat. The surface of chicken is often contaminated with bacteria, which can multiply rapidly under refrigeration temperatures. If raw chicken is not cooked properly, these bacteria can cause foodborne illnesses, such as Salmonella and Campylobacter. To safely store raw chicken, wrap it tightly in plastic wrap or place it in an airtight container and freeze it for up to 9 months. When you are ready to cook the chicken, thaw it in the refrigerator overnight or under cold running water for several hours.
